You noticed the question marks in this title. It is intentional, because we’re trying to figure out what to officially call these quarterly podcast-like videos we’re doing form our studio in the Twin Cities.

So, what are these videos? What would like these to be called? Are these podcasts? News programs? Utter BS? Are you bored by now?

OK, we’re going overboard here. What we have for you this week is more of a shake-up from our last such video. We include a news piece, a perspective of the Chicago, Twin Cities, and New York auto shows, and a few vehicles we drove recently. 

Here is our second quarterly report…review…or, whatever you want to call it?

About Victory & Reseda

Victory & Reseda is a website/blog telling the story of the automobile through the eyes of freelance automotive writer Randy Stern and friends. This website/blog serves as a virtual intersection of the automobile, its culture, the past, present and future of personal transportation. It also features travel pieces that center on the automotive experience.
